Definitions:

Leasehold Estate

An interest in real property allowing the holder to use and occupy the land or property for a specific period, under a lease agreement.

Freehold Estate

A type of real property ownership where the owner has indefinite duration of ownership rights, including the land and buildings.

Life Estate

A property interest that lasts for the lifetime of a specific individual, after which the property passes to another recipient.

Joint Tenancy

A form of property co-ownership that provides each tenant with an equal share and rights in the property, with the provision of right of survivorship.
